WebbThe National Union of Teachers (NUT) provides guidance on class sizes and advises schools to consider children’s emotional, behavioural and special needs when … Webb10A NCAC 09 .0713 STAFF/CHILD RATIOS FOR CENTERS (a) The staff/child ratios and group sizes for single-age groups of children in centers shall be as follows: Age of Children Ratio Staff/Children Maximum Group Size 0 to 12 Months 1/5 10 12 to 24 Months 1/6 12 2 to 3 Years 1/10 20 3 to 4 Years 1/15 25 4 to 5 Years 1/20 25
